Buyer agrees to feed this puppy, large breed puppy food until the recommended age of removal, recommended by the puppy food manufacturer. Puppy food is designed for puppies to ensure that they grow at a proper rate. Feeding too high of a performance food, before a pup is matured may promote rapid growth which is not healthy for a dogs bones and hips.
If buyer is considering breeding this pup, OFA Hip certification must be done between the age of 24-26 months of age to ensure an accurate reading.
